Subject. Methods for Short‑Term Forecasting of Stock Prices of Russian Public Companies Based on Neural Network Technologies. Objectives. To develop a model for short‑term forecasting of stock prices of Russian public companies using a neural network, and to create a comprehensive solution for scenario analysis of price movement trajectories across the entire market to enable the formation and calibration of a securities portfolio. Methods. The study used stock price data for public companies listed on the Moscow Exchange (442,674 quotes) from 2014 onwards. The batch download method of the Moexalgo service was applied. Subsequently, deep learning techniques were employed, within the framework of which a neural network with a long short‑term memory (LSTM) architecture was constructed. Results. Models were developed for 173 Russian public companies. These models enable stock prices to be forecasted with fairly high accuracy for a 30‑day horizon based on historical data series, which can improve short‑term strategy in securities portfolio management. Conclusions and Relevance. The obtained results can be applied to form a theoretical securities portfolio for the Russian market in order to develop a short‑term financial strategy. The results can be used by financial analysts, traders, and valuation specialists when modelling a portfolio of financial investments.
